UFC The Ultimate Fighting Championship (UFC) is a U.S.-based mixed martial arts organization, recognized as the largest MMA promotion in the world. The UFC is headquartered in Las Vegas, Nevada and is owned and operated by Zuffa, LLC. This promotion is responsible for solidifying the sport's postion in the history-books. UFC is currently undergoing a remarkable surge in popularity, along with greater mainstream media coverage. UFC programming can now be seen on FOX, FX, and FUEL TV in the United States, as well as in 35 other countries worldwide.

World MMA Awards debuts Jan. 20 on FOX Sports Net

Quote:
FOX Sports Net will air the 2012 World MMA Awards ceremony on Jan. 20 at 9 p.m. ET/PT, officials recently announced.

Additionally, FUEL TV will air replays at a variety of times.

The actual 2012 World MMA Awards ceremony takes place this Friday at The Joint at Hard Rock Hotel and Casino in Las Vegas.

Fighters Only coordinates the annual awards, in which fans vote for winners in 21 different categories. The awards recognize achievements from Sept. 1, 2011, to Sept. 30, 2012.
